The GARTREE Division, in south-east Leicestershire (named after the Roman Road), consists of three District Wards: Kibworth, Glen, and Billesdon following the District Boundary changes in 2002, and County Boundary changes of 2004.  Two whole wards: Glen, and Kibworth (now including the Langtons) and the southern five parishes of one ward (Billesdon Ward) fall within the Harborough parliamentary constituency (Edward Garnier QC MP) and the remaining eight parishes of the Billesdon Ward (northern parishes) are within the Rutland and Melton parliamentary constituency (Alan Duncan MP). There are twenty-six parishes in the new GARTREE Division, making it one of the largest divisions in the County.

Leicestershire County Council is responsible for county strategic plans including highways, transport and structure planning, trading standards, education, social services, libraries, museums, youth and community education.

Harborough District Council is responsible for collecting waste, collecting your Council Tax, local planning and developments, and housing.

Glen Ward (2001 Census populations in brackets - Total: 3,876; Households: 1,661) - Electorate 2002: 3,287 in 5 parishes

The most westerly ward straddles the A6 trunk road and includes Great Glen (3,275), Wistow with Newton Harcourt (292), Little Stretton (97), Burton Overy (275) and Carlton Curlieu (49). Glen Ward unemployment data for January 2005 (0.9% overall) (changes compared to March 2003): Males 15 (1.2%), Females 7 (0.6%). A specific page for Glen Ward issues is now available.

Kibworth Ward (2001 Census populations in brackets - Total: 6,081; Households: 2,461) - Electorate 2002: 4,911 in 8 parishes

The most populated ward at the southern end of the division lies, more or less, between the A6 trunk road and B6047 and includes Kibworth Beauchamp (3,798; households = 1,533; electorate March 2004 was 3,085), Kibworth Harcourt (990; households = 425; electorate January 2005 was 837) and Smeeton Westerby (340; households = 149) together with 5 parishes from the old Langton Ward: Shangton (149), Tur Langton (172), West Langton (128; households = 40), East Langton incl. Church Langton (351; households = 142), Thorpe Langton (171; households = 71). Kibworth Ward unemployment data for January 2005: Kibworth (0.7% overall):- Males 19 (1.0%), Females 5 (0.3%). Billesdon Ward (2001 Census populations in brackets - Total: 1,586; Households: 697) - Electorate 2002:  1,345 in 13 parishes

This most northerly ward lies wholly within the new Gartree Division (as shown on above map). The northerly part includes 8 parishes: Billesdon, Frisby, Gaulby, King's Norton, Illston on the Hill, Rolleston, Noseley, and Goadby.  The southerly part includes 5 parishes: Welham (32), Slawston (141), Glooston (53), Cranoe (32) and Stonton Wyville (23). Billesdon Ward unemployment data for January 2005 (0.6% overall): Males 5 (1.0%), Females 1 (0.2%).
